Output e3fc88c681f247885778ccbdd658fcfe86da7d2af95c1c136ad1a6784cc95043:21

value
112098
script pubkey
OP_0 OP_PUSHBYTES_20 e39f9bc8ba372a70389e0358e41230aa1c8d29ff
address
bc1quw0ehj96xu48qwy7qdvwgy3s4gwg620l535xrr
transaction
e3fc88c681f247885778ccbdd658fcfe86da7d2af95c1c136ad1a6784cc95043
spent
true